Ndatabase sql commands pdf

Sql commands are mainly classified into four types, which are ddl command, dml command, tcl command and dcl command sql is mainly divided into four sub language. The worlds largest community of sql server professionals. These commands can be classified into the following groups based on their nature. Sql guys have always asked if they should look after the smssql server.

To run an administrative command against the admin database, use db. Create to create objects in the database alter alters the structure of the database drop delete objects from the database truncate remove all records from a. Tsql contains a set of programming extensions that adds several features to basic sql. Sql server flavor of sql is called transact sql or tsql for short. Your input is an important part of the information used for revision. Sql, structured query language, is a programming language designed to manage data stored in relational databases. The database management system is the software that allows access to the database and to apply sql. Lists sql syntax for the sql commands listed in the 1keydata sql tutorial. About the tutorial sql tutorial sql is a database computer language designed for the retrieval and management of data in relational database.

Data definition languageddl data manipulation languagedml transaction control languagetcl. The sql update clause is very powerful and you can easily alter one or more table entries by mistake, thus losing their original values. The oracle database sql language quick reference is intended for all users of oracle sql. Note that sql 3 sql commands the standard sql commands to interact with relational databases are create, select, insert, update, delete and drop. Appendix e glossary of common sql commands the asterisk character returns all the columns of a particular table. Objectives after completing this lesson, you should be able to do the following. Commands that we use to create and alter object structures in the database. These sql commands are used for creating, modifying, and dropping the structure of database objects. The attacker cannot insert to inject more sql commands.

The call to nnect opens the database file, and creates a cursor. This command enables the user to execute a number of commands from a script file rather than manually typing them all into isql at the prompt. Tutorial structured query language in base view topic. Is it possible to enter a command line command like in a batch file to attach a detached database to sql server, in stead of opening the management studio and doing it in there. The commands in sql are called queries and they are of two types. Basic sql commands allow the user to achieve significant manipulation of data in the database. In the example above, i have used the execute command to run a couple of queries, first to get all records in the table temps and then to. Google advertisements sql command dml command in sql. Most relational database management systems use the sql language to access the database. Software testing jobs sql commands and operations sql is a command based language, used for storing and managing data in rdbms. The statements which defines the structure of a database, create tables, specify their keys, indexes and so on. Advanced sql queries, examples of queries in sql list of. Database console commands sql server microsoft docs. The sections that follow show each sql statement and its related syntax.

Audience this reference has been prepared for the beginners to help them understand the basic to advanced. The script may contain any mix of ddl andor ddl commands, along with isql commands to redirect output, change options, etc. List the capabilities of sql select statements execute a basic select statement differentiate between sql statements and sqlplus commands lesson aim to extract data from the database. Refer to chapter 5, subclauses for the syntax of the subclauses found in the following table. Ddl data definition language command description create creates a new table, a view of a table, or other object in the database. Sql is incredibly powerful, and like every wellmade development tool, it has a few commands which its vital for a good developer to know. Introduction to sql finding your way around the server.

Gehrke 2 example instances sid sname rating age 22 dustin 7 45. The abilities of the select command forms the majority of this material on sql. There is also a set of commands that mysql itself interprets. Sql is a data sub language dsl this is a combination of two languages ddl data definition language dml data manipulation language the main way of accessing data is using the dml command select. A relational database management system rdbms is a program that allows you to create, update, and administer a relational database. Sql 3 sql commands the standard sql commands to interact with relational databases are create, select, insert, update, delete and drop.

Mysql basic database administration commands part i. Sql, s tructured q uery l anguage, is a programming language designed to manage data stored in relational databases. Additional features of sql techniques for specifying complex retrieval queries writing programs in various programming languages that include sql statements set of commands for specifying physical database design parameters, file structures for relations. For a list of these commands, type help or \h at the mysql prompt.

I structured query language i usually talk to a database server i used as front end to many databases mysql, postgresql, oracle, sybase i three subsystems. Refer to chapter 5, subclauses for the syntax of the subclauses listed in the syntax for the statements. Queries, programming, triggers chapter 5 database management systems 3ed, r. Sql facts sql stands for structured query language data. B1075801 oracle corporation welcomes your comments and suggestions on the quality and usefulness of this publication. Each of the queries in our sql tutorial is consequential to almost every system that interacts with an sql database. Data definition languagedml statements are used to define data structures in database. Databases can be found in almost all software applications. Its syntax varies widely among different database systems. Ive always said to leave it alone just make sure the sms backup is working and there is a system backup running each day to have an offline copy additionally, i followed the sql maintenance tasks from the sms 2003 admin companion steven kaczmarek pages 700701. Oracle database recovery manager reference 10g release 1 10. Since a single server can support many databases, each containing many tables, with each table having a variety of columns, its easy to get lost when youre working with databases. Learn vocabulary, terms, and more with flashcards, games, and other study tools. The concept of database was known to our ancestors even when there were no computers, however creating and maintaining such database was very tedious job.

Sql operates through simple, declarative statements. Sql database commands and queries how to create databse query in mysql, how to drop database query. A simple guide to mysql basic database administration commands. Database is a structured set of data stored electronically. Sql doesnt have control flow conditional, loop, and branching statements, but sql has comments, data types, operator. This 3page sql cheat sheet provides you with the most commonly used sql statements.

Sql statements are the means by which programs and users access data in an oracle database. This keeps data accurate and secure, and it helps maintain the integrity of databases, regardless of size. The product or products described in this book are licens ed products of teradata corporation or its affiliates. The typical command is comprised of several different components including clauses, functions, expressions, or objects but the only required components are a sql clause and. The entire documentation on how to control a running hsqldb is written by means of sql commands since most databases run without graphical pointandclick interface. How to attach a sql server database from the command line. The alter databasestatement changes the size or settings of a database. Oracle database sql quick reference, 10g release 1 10. Introduction to structured query language version 4.

Sql s tructured q uery l anguage is a programming language used to communicate with data stored in a relational database. Here i am trying to give a full instant guide to mysql commands that will help people for their easy usage. Pdf version of tsql tutorial with content of stored procedures, sql tutorial, cursors, triggers, views, functions, data types, table joins, transactions, interview questions. The cursor object is then used to execute sql commands. Sql server azure sql database managed instance only azure synapse analytics sql dw parallel data warehouse sql server provides the following management commands. Download the sql cheat sheet, print it out, and stick to your desk.

The following list gives an overview of the tsql commands and their classification. Our sql update statement above simply instructs says that the new value of averagetemperature will be equal to the old one plus 5. Table 11 shows each sql statement and its related syntax. An az index of the sql server 2005 database create aggregate drop aggregate create application role alter application role drop application role create assembly alter assembly drop assembly alter authorization b backup backup certificate bcp bulk copy begin dialog conversation.

This tutorial prepares the oracle database 10g express edition developer to. Sql p ermits as bet w een relation and its tuple v ariable. Forum rules no question in this forum please for any question related to a topic, create a new thread in the relevant section. Teradata database sql data definition language syntax and examples release. Basic sql commands in database management systems dbms. Sql commands are declarative sentences or orders executed against a sql database. Sql ddl command data definition languagedml statements are used to define data structures in database. My assumptions about you you may be a dba administrator or dba developer.

1053 1339 35 669 419 618 551 452 631 318 338 814 297 1173 453 1394 523 293 1054 187 470 688 796 1529 780 439 1306 419 572 1192 634 1352 1368